Incomplete set-up of Roku Premiere streaming device

During the set-up of my device, I got through the software scan successfully and got the bouncing ROKU  logo then the screen went blank. I did not receive the request for my email address nor did I get any activation code.  I have tried using the "home button" on the ROKU remote, have powered it down and back up again and done a factory reset. Still have a blank screen. I have already opened a Roku account on-line prior to installation. How can I complete the set-up and start using the device?

Re: Incomplete set-up of Roku Premiere streaming device

I'd try a hard reset and start over again. Somewhere on the body of the player is a small hole, and there's a button recessed in that hole. Use a paperclip or something similar and hold the button for a minimum of 30 seconds, not one second less. Ignore anything happening on the screen until the 30 seconds passes. Then let it reboot and see if it returns to the initial setup screen. 

If it doesn't, then the player is probably defective. Unfortunately it happens even with new devices. I had a brand new Roku TV that got stuck a setup loop. I returned it for a new one and that has now been in use for about 5 years.

Re: Incomplete set-up of Roku Premiere streaming device

Highly unlikely it would be the TV port, but it's always worth trying a different one. 

The 10 second hard reset is for Roku TVs. For Roku players, it requires the full 30 seconds.

If you don't get anything in the other port, you could try a completely different TV if possible. But the dancing Roku logo should be visible at the least during the boot. If you don't even see that, then there's been a hardware failure and you should exchange it wherever you purchased it.

Re: Incomplete set-up of Roku Premiere streaming device

Before I boxed it up to return I decided to give it one more try.  I changed the HDMI port and it worked.  I was able to complete the set-up and activation.  Everything now working fine.
